Output a3643898285ade101c3058fc6b8862155b56324a5d890c2317423dac0097e976:1

value
76980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ec8c15bfd12beb6b8dc612f685a222ecefe93fd OP_EQUALVERIFY OP_CHECKSIG
address
1CZNdtrksMRBGyqf56q4zUs7MW1cqZqH3R
transaction
a3643898285ade101c3058fc6b8862155b56324a5d890c2317423dac0097e976
spent
true